From 7901dc91e1125aa90c7fbd547d5f80eedfeed8ec Mon Sep 17 00:00:00 2001 From: Jakob Unterwurzacher Date: Sat, 26 Apr 2025 11:27:27 +0200 Subject: darwin: tests/defaults: fix unix.Getdents build failure Error was: + go test -c -tags without_openssl -o /dev/null github.com/rfjakob/gocryptfs/v2/tests/defaults Error: tests/defaults/main_test.go:532:17: undefined: unix.Getdents Error: tests/defaults/main_test.go:538:16: undefined: unix.Getdents Error: tests/defaults/main_test.go:549:16: undefined: unix.Getdents --- tests/defaults/getdents_linux.go | 9 +++++++++ 1 file changed, 9 insertions(+) create mode 100644 tests/defaults/getdents_linux.go (limited to 'tests/defaults/getdents_linux.go') diff --git a/tests/defaults/getdents_linux.go b/tests/defaults/getdents_linux.go new file mode 100644 index 0000000..57956ce --- /dev/null +++ b/tests/defaults/getdents_linux.go @@ -0,0 +1,9 @@ +package defaults + +import ( + "golang.org/x/sys/unix" +) + +func getdents(fd int, buf []byte) (int, error) { + return unix.Getdents(fd, buf) +} -- cgit v1.2.3